Unhappy OMG! THE VORTECH IS GONE !!! very well damaged !

Feel my pain guys !!!!

First, I bought this kit one or two months ago....

I put 2300 miles with the kit on my car, out of the box, without any probs... until yesterday...

Yesterday evening, I heard a strange noise that came from the Vortech... a jet plane engine BUT at the idle... normaly the Vortech kit is making a lot of noise at the idle, but not like this...not before...? and the noise went away after few minutes....

Today, I took my car to go to work... and the stange noise was there at the morning start, but more louder....

I took my car out for the dinner, same thing, BUT this time the noise did not get away... and as I drove, it starded to became lounder... I stopped the car, on the side of the road and I simply remove the cogged belt, behind the Vortech... and the 15 amp fuse for the inline fuel pump...

at the end of my working day, today... I remove the air filter from the Vortech and OH MY GOD !!!!

we can see some contact traces between the turbine impeller and the housing... and it is pretty hard to turn with my hand...

that rocks in the blower sound is solved just by raising the idle
going to a 3.12 or 2.87 or 34 tooth rear cog pulley helps too by spinning the blower faster so the noise stops

that's an unrelated issue to the blower being damaged though in this case

Thats sucks we just got your other R4 problem figured out . It only a few months old , Vortech will cover the blower . All you need to do is call Vortech and tell them whats going on . They will give you a number to put on the box you ship it in . While you have it off , check the intercooler pipe all the way to the intercooler to make sure no shavings of the impeller is in there .
